Transaction 150349382d96cfe77fd5d36c7771f0d78f9f81e50b637f99d2ae1b517fd413a5

1 Input
2 Outputs
  • 150349382d96cfe77fd5d36c7771f0d78f9f81e50b637f99d2ae1b517fd413a5:0
  • value  1000000
    address  1774fiAhCZaYcEqh65MoRAsRzmCMTwrdry
  • 150349382d96cfe77fd5d36c7771f0d78f9f81e50b637f99d2ae1b517fd413a5:1
  • value  11197297
    address  15aiHSFZN82LerSE7dkSrZ3Y3SgnFxm3Qy